Exploring the Features of This Innovative Tool
I've been using the Inkbird Wireless Meat Thermometer with its 4 probes for a while now, and it's been a game-changer for my grilling and roasting sessions. The digital display shows precise temperatures for each probe together,making it easy to monitor multiple foods at once. The probes are equipped with strong magnets, so they stick to the side of the grill or oven effortlessly. Best of all, the Inkbird app connects via WiFi or Bluetooth, allowing me to set tailored menus and receive high alerts on my phone, even when I'm not within the Bluetooth range. The unit is IP67 waterproof and can be easily cleaned in the dishwasher, which is a huge plus for maintaining hygiene.
The device offers three connection modes: WiFi for unlimited range, Bluetooth for up to 300 feet, and a non-phone connect mode for those who prefer not to use their devices. Each probe features dual temperature sensors to accurately track both internal and ambient temperatures. I particularly love the 2.24x4 inch backlit LCD screen, which displays real-time data clearly, even in bright sunlight. With a battery life of up to 25 hours per charge, it's ready for long cooking sessions without frequent recharges.
